# Unleashing the Power of Visualization: An In-depth Look at Word Clouds in Modern Data Analysis
In the realm of data analysis, one faces a challenge to sift through vast volumes of text-based information, making sense out of it, and deriving meaningful patterns or insights. Traditional methods of text analysis, involving parsing through each document, counting word frequencies, and potentially performing more complex natural language processing tasks, can be laborious and time-consuming. Enter word clouds – a visual representation designed to engage the eye and facilitate the interpretation of large datasets with minimal effort.
## What are Word Clouds?
Word clouds are a type of visual representation often used in data visualization. They are designed to display an image with words (often keywords or tags) in varying sizes based on their frequency within a text corpus. Typically, larger words denote higher frequency, allowing viewers to quickly gauge the importance or prevalence of certain themes, sentiments, or keywords.
## The Power of Word Clouds: A Data Analysis Perspective
### 1. **Enhancement of Interpretation**
Word clouds serve as an initial filtering tool for textual data, aiding analysts in identifying key concepts or high-frequency terms at a glance. This can be particularly advantageous when dealing with unstructured or semi-structured data, such as customer reviews, social media posts, or any vast collection of textual information. By visualizing these terms, users can quickly identify predominant topics without the need for exhaustive reading or manual keyword extraction.
### 2. **Effective Communication**
In the context of data analysis, the insights derived from word clouds can be quickly communicated to stakeholders in a compelling, compelling visual format. This visual representation makes it easy for non-technical audiences to understand the essence of the data, making the findings more accessible and impactful. Whether presenting findings from market research, summarizing opinions for a public relations team, or analyzing trends in social media analytics, word clouds can serve as powerful communication tools.
### 3. **Discovery of Hidden Patterns**
By visualizing a large dataset with word clouds, analysts can uncover patterns and insights that might not be immediately obvious through textual analysis alone. The spatial arrangement and relative sizes of words help highlight co-occurrences or clusters of related terms. This is especially useful in exploratory data analysis, where the objective is to open up new lines of inquiry without definitive hypotheses.
### 4. **Efficiency in Time-Saving**
Analyzing word clouds can save significant time compared to traditional, manual content analysis methods. This is particularly valuable in scenarios where the volume of data is large or when the analysis requires frequent updating. Automated tools can generate word clouds with minimal input, making it an efficient preliminary step in any text analysis workflow.
### 5. **Personalization and Customization for Specific Needs**
Word clouds are highly customizable, allowing users to adjust parameters such as font size, color schemes, and shape to suit their specific needs. This personalization caters to diverse preferences and analysis needs, be it highlighting the most important terms in blue for quick identification or varying color themes to represent different aspects of the data.
### 6. **Integration with Advanced Data Analysis Tools**
Word clouds can be integrated into more complex data analysis workflows. For example, they can serve as a starting point for sentiment analysis, providing a preliminary view of topics and sentiments before performing detailed sentiment classification. They can also be combined with geographic mapping to explore regional trends or with network analysis to understand connections between terms in a more structured data set.
### Tools and Platforms for Generating Word Clouds
– **WordClouds**: An online platform that offers a range of customization options and supports various file formats for easy export.
– **d3.js**: A JavaScript library used for creating interactive and dynamic data visualizations, including word clouds, in web applications.
– **R and Python libraries**: Libraries like `wordcloud` in R and `wordcloud` and `matplotlib` in Python provide extensive functionalities for creating and customizing word clouds.
– **Excel or Google Sheets plugins and add-ins**: Various tools are available that allow users to generate word clouds within spreadsheet applications, leveraging their existing data analysis infrastructure.
## Conclusion
Word clouds represent a significant advancement in the field of data visualization, offering a concise, intuitive, and efficient way to handle and interpret large volumes of textual data. Their ability to quickly highlight key themes and patterns while avoiding the need for complex natural language processing tasks makes them a versatile tool in the modern data analysis toolkit. Whether aiding in academic research, improving customer insights in marketing, or enhancing understanding in social media analytics, word clouds serve as an indispensable asset in extracting meaningful, actionable insights from textual data.
WordCloudMaster
Explore creative possibilities with WordCloudMaster! No matter where you are, you can easily create stunning word clouds from your iPhone, iPad or Mac.
Whether you are a data analyst, a creator, a word worker, or a word cloud enthusiast, this app is your best creative partner. Download it now and unleash your imagination to create unique word cloud art!

